Transaction 8bbae74c4de7ab75be952f8173f22f20e273da2273ec05cd723e049670cc48e6
1 Input
1 Output
-
8bbae74c4de7ab75be952f8173f22f20e273da2273ec05cd723e049670cc48e6:0
- value
- 65880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02289b35baa70e8207a063f2e0e8d364551cfbd2 OP_EQUAL
- address
- 31tRvJTY1tQ3BD2aHegkZEpoRdZfJex1WE